Ponzu by Gonzo Seeds
Indica-dominant × Sativa-dominant
Ponzu is a hybrid cannabis strain developed by Gonzo Seeds, noted for its meticulous blend of indica and sativa genetics. This carefully crafted profile aims to offer a harmonious balance of uplifting and calming sensations, making it a popular choice for both new and experienced consumers.
Appearance
Ponzu buds are visually dense and heavily coated in trichomes, often displaying deep colors with vibrant accents. The plants themselves can exhibit leaf variations from deep green to purple, depending on cultivation conditions. Under optimal growth, Ponzu plants reach a moderate height, typically between 60 to 90 centimeters, with a structure that balances broad indica-like leaves and a more airy sativa form.
The buds are characterized by slender, fiery orange pistils that contrast with the frosty trichomes. This aesthetic appeal, combined with robust structure and high resin production, makes it attractive for craft cannabis markets.
Aroma & Flavor
The aroma of Ponzu is predominantly citrusy, often likened to freshly squeezed lemon or the zest of Ponzu sauce, which inspired its name. This bright top note is complemented by subtle undertones of pine and earthy nuances, creating a complex and invigorating scent profile.
Consumers frequently report tasting these aromatic notes, with the citrus and lemon flavors being most prominent, followed by hints of pine, fruit, and an earthy, pungent finish. This combination contributes to its widely appealing sensory experience.
Effects
Ponzu is recognized for delivering a balanced set of effects that combine cerebral stimulation with physical relaxation. Users often experience a sense of calm without significant sedation, alongside a gentle uplift that can enhance mood and focus.
The strain's balanced genetic heritage is thought to contribute to its nuanced effects, providing a versatile experience that can be suitable for various times of day and user preferences.
Terpenes & Cannabinoids
Laboratory analyses indicate that Ponzu typically exhibits THC levels ranging from 15% to 25%, with CBD content below 1%. This cannabinoid profile supports its balanced effects.
Key terpenes identified in Ponzu include Limonene, Caryophyllene, and Pinene. Limonene is largely responsible for the strain's prominent citrus aroma and flavor, while Pinene contributes to the pine notes. Caryophyllene adds depth and may contribute to the strain's calming properties.
Growing
Ponzu is considered adaptable for both indoor and outdoor cultivation, reaching moderate heights with robust structure. Growers have reported significant yields, potentially up to 600 grams per square meter under optimal conditions, attributed to its dense bud formation and high resin production.
The strain's genetic stability ensures predictable growth patterns and consistent quality, making it a reliable option for cultivators. Environmental factors can influence its specific aromatic characteristics.
Origins & Lineage
Ponzu was meticulously bred by Gonzo Seeds, a breeder known for combining traditional and modern genetics. The strain's creation involved a dedication to enhancing the best traits from both indica and sativa lineages.
Its genetic makeup is reported to be a near 50/50 balance of indica and sativa, a deliberate choice by Gonzo Seeds to achieve a harmonious profile. While the specific parent strains are closely guarded, the lineage reflects a commitment to quality and innovation in cannabis breeding.
